Output 6ae68ac38910cca23f3173925e82d3b53e9b19d44e1ae0259d9260ed08d37ff5:0

value
841778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71e57003a752534faa4e8d1b7e21ab80d6eb3510 OP_EQUAL
address
3C5F8pbaQdbPLrygFLLUTDgnXFM1iPpHHj
transaction
6ae68ac38910cca23f3173925e82d3b53e9b19d44e1ae0259d9260ed08d37ff5
confirmations
287222
spent
true